Devlalgaon Population -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and
Devlalgaon is a medium size village located in Pithoragarh Tehsil of Pithoragarh district, Uttarakhand with total 64 families residing. The Devlalgaon village has population of 276 of which 141 are males while 135 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Devlalgaon village population of children with age 0-6 is 39 which makes up 14.13 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Devlalgaon village is 957 which is lower than Uttarakhand state average of 963. Child Sex Ratio for the Devlalgaon as per census is 857, lower than Uttarakhand average of 890.
Devlalgaon village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ttarakh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Devlalgaon village was 88.61 % compared to 78.82 % of Uttarakhand. In Devlalgaon Male literacy stands at 95.83 % while female literacy rate was 81.20 %.

Devlalgaon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 64 | - | - |
Population | 276 | 141 | 135 |
Child (0-6) | 39 | 21 | 18 |
Schedule Caste | 4 | 2 | 2 |
Schedule Tribe | 7 | 5 | 2 |
Literacy | 88.61 % | 95.83 % | 81.20 % |
Total Workers | 128 | 65 | 63 |
Main Worker | 127 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 1 | 1 | 0 |
